Project Blackbox

I just got back from my 2 weeks of annual army reservist training. I belong to the Signal vocation, you know, the people who carry radio sets with long antenna sticking out and aways the first sniper's target :p. Anyway, I realized that today, technology plays a vital role in modern warfare. I believe many modern army are using technology to speed up information update, e.g. monitor the battle progress in real time by the command center; command your troops using point and click like playing Command & Conquer (well, not quite there yet, but not totally impossible).

Now that I'm back, I came across something new in several of the blogs. I find it such a cool idea that I have to put it here: Introducing the "world's first virtualized data center", Project Blackbox. I say put it on a truck with a satellite connection and you got a moving command center! Well, probably not for the military, but what about a disaster recovery coordinating center? Think Katrina and Tsunami...
